WebHenry Moseley was a British physicist who made important contributions to the understanding of the structure of atoms. He was born in 1887 in Weymouth, England and studied physics at Oxford University. One of Moseley's most significant contributions was his work on the concept of atomic number.
Henry Gwyn Jeffreys Moseley was an English physicist, whose contribution to the science of physics was the justification from physical laws of the previous empirical and chemical concept of the atomic number. This stemmed from his development of Moseley's law in X-ray spectra. Moseley's law advanced atomic physics, nuclear physics and quantum physic…
